Cerebral insurRectiOn

it was a party of peace, serene and divine,
not a sound or thought my soul could find.

thought came, with his thinking friends, 
in worry they huddled and trouble begin.

doubt was conductor, of confusion and fear, 
as they all competed for an attentive ear. 

sadness arrived and cased the room,
looking for partners in the dance of gloom.

faith stepped in, banishing thoughts of alarm
followed by stillness and all grew calm.

they scurried about searching for shade,
back to the silence where they were made.

by K. Osei
